Helios X Group is seeking an Engineering Facilities Manager to lead the development and delivery of world-class engineering, facilities and infrastructure at our Leamington Spa site.

You will drive operational excellence with innovative engineering solutions and automation to boost productivity and ROI.

You will own UK Engineering, Facilities and Infrastructure, shaping long-term strategy and ensuring smooth day-to-day operations, enabling growth across sites globally.
